AGRICULTURE IN BRITAIN.

REPORT TO BE OBTAINED. Bv Telegraph.—Press Assn.— Copyright London, Dec. 11. Mr. Bonar Law. in the House of Commons said the Government proposed to appoint a tribunal comprising three commissioners to enquire into the methods adopted in other countries, including the Dominions, during tne last fiftv years to increase the prosperity of agriculture and secure the full use of the land for the production of food and the employment of labor at a living wage, and to advise on the best methods of achieving these results. Aus.-N.Z. Cable Association.
